How can you handle changing business requirements in a dimensional model for analytics?
Data engineering is the process of designing, building, and maintaining data pipelines and systems that enable analytics and business intelligence. One of the challenges that data engineers face is how to handle changing business requirements in a dimensional model for analytics. A dimensional model is a type of data model that organizes data into facts and dimensions, where facts are numerical measures of business events and dimensions are descriptive attributes that provide context and meaning to the facts. Dimensional models are widely used for analytics and BI because they are easy to understand, query, and optimize.